Silver Price Today, 30 March 2026: Silver prices have seen a slight decrease, with international spot silver trading at approximately $68.58 per ounce, down about 1.75%. Prices are under pressure due to a strengthening US dollar index and rising Treasury yields, despite ongoing geopolitical tensions. In India, the domestic price for 999 fine silver has settled at ₹2,44,900 per kilogram, a marginal dip of ₹100 from the previous day.

Key Market Drivers

  • MCX Performance: On the Multi Commodity Exchange, silver was trading around ₹2,27,750 per kg, reflecting a minor intraday dip of 0.09%.
  • Monthly Trend: Silver has corrected by approximately 16.98% in March 2026, falling from a peak of over ₹3.15 lakh per kg earlier in the month.
  • Economic Factors: Investors are cautious ahead of US Federal Reserve policy meetings and significant non-farm payrolls data, which typically impact precious metal demand.
  • Regional Premiums: Southern cities like Chennai, Hyderabad, and Kerala continue to command a ₹5,000 premium per kg due to higher local demand.

Key Considerations for Buyers

  • Taxes: Domestic purchases are subject to a 3% GST in addition to the quoted market price.
  • Making Charges: For physical silver items like utensils or jewellery, making charges typically range from 5% to 25%.
  • Investment Options: Besides physical bars, investors can consider Silver ETFs or digital silver for cost-effective and liquid exposure.
